Transaction 88ffca90e728a97307f402f7cfc29eb2a1efe66532d2d03b23b6443aa9740ab3

3 Input
2 Outputs
  • 88ffca90e728a97307f402f7cfc29eb2a1efe66532d2d03b23b6443aa9740ab3:0
  • value  126279218
    address  1C222g1MDgwumw4aUV9iVfkNUGXNmacXUW
  • 88ffca90e728a97307f402f7cfc29eb2a1efe66532d2d03b23b6443aa9740ab3:1
  • value  501000000
    address  1Cb6UBGUMihNBpT3h4G1uuvBkidphVteFQ